html表单
时间: 2023-06-30 21:23:08 浏览: 83
HTML表单是一个用户界面元素,它包含用于收集用户输入的各种表单元素,例如文本输入框、下拉列表、单选按钮、复选框等。当用户提交表单时,它将被发送到服务器进行处理。以下是一个简单的HTML表单示例:
```html
<form action="/submit-form" method="POST">
<label for="name">Name:</label>
<input type="text" id="name" name="name" required>
<label for="email">Email:</label>
<input type="email" id="email" name="email" required>
<label for="message">Message:</label>
<textarea id="message" name="message" required></textarea>
<button type="submit">Submit</button>
</form>
```
这个表单包括三个表单元素:一个文本框、一个电子邮件输入框和一个文本区域,以及一个提交按钮。当用户点击提交按钮时,表单数据将被发送到服务器的“/submit-form”端点,使用POST方法。此外,每个表单元素都有一个“required”属性,这意味着用户必须填写它们才能提交表单。
相关问题
html表单select
<select>标签用于在HTML表单中创建下拉菜单。它可以通过设置name属性来定义表单字段的名称,并通过设置size属性来指定下拉菜单的可见选项数。此外,也可以使用multiple属性来允许用户进行多选操作。每个选项都可以使用<option>标签来定义,其中的value属性用于指定将发送到服务器的选项值,selected属性可以设置选项的初始选中状态。下面是一个示例代码:
<select name="example">
<option value="option1" selected>选项1</option>
<option value="option2">选项2</option>
...
</select>
以上是关于HTML表单中<select>标签的基本用法和语法。如果您还有其他相关问题,请随时提问。
相关问题:
1. <select>标签有哪些常用属性?
2. 如何设置下拉菜单的默认选项?
3. 如何在下拉菜单中添加一个空选项?
4. 如何使用JavaScript动态改变下拉菜单的选项?
5. 在表单中如何获取用户选择的下拉菜单的值?
html表单制作
HTML表单是一种通过Web页面收集用户输入数据的方式。以下是制作HTML表单的基本步骤:
1. 使用HTML中的`<form>`元素创建表单,定义表单的属性,例如method和action等。
2. 在表单中添加各种输入元素,例如文本框、单选框、复选框、下拉列表等。每个输入元素都需要一个唯一的name属性,用于在提交表单时标识输入的数据。
3. 使用HTML中的`<label>`元素为每个输入元素创建标签,标签中的for属性应该指向对应输入元素的id属性。
4. 添加提交按钮,使用HTML中的`<input>`元素,type属性设置为submit。
下面是一个简单的HTML表单示例:
```
<form action="process.php" method="post">
<label for="name">姓名:</label>
<input type="text" id="name" name="name"><br>
<label for="gender">性别:</label>
<input type="radio" id="male" name="gender" value="male">
<label for="male">男</label>
<input type="radio" id="female" name="gender" value="female">
<label for="female">女</label><br>
<label for="hobby">爱好:</label>
<input type="checkbox" id="reading" name="hobby[]" value="reading">
<label for="reading">阅读</label>
<input type="checkbox" id="sports" name="hobby[]" value="sports">
<label for="sports">运动</label><br>
<label for="city">城市:</label>
<select id="city" name="city">
<option value="beijing">北京</option>
<option value="shanghai">上海</option>
<option value="guangzhou">广州</option>
<option value="shenzhen">深圳</option>
</select><br>
<input type="submit" value="提交">
</form>
```
在这个例子中,我们创建了一个包含姓名、性别、爱好和城市的表单。当用户提交表单时,表单数据将被发送到`process.php`进行处理。其中,姓名是一个文本输入框,性别是两个单选框中的一个,爱好是两个复选框中的一个或多个,城市是一个下拉列表。